Date: Mon, 28 May 2007 20:54:22 -0500 Message-ID: <465B87CE.6030801@codemonkey.ws> Mime-Version: 1.0 Content-Type: text/plain; charset="us-ascii" Content-Transfer-Encoding: 7bit To: kvm-devel Return-path: List-Unsubscribe: , List-Archive: List-Post: List-Help: List-Subscribe: , Sender: kvm-devel-bounces-5NWGOfrQmneRv+LV9MX5uipxlwaOVQ5f@public.gmane.org Errors-To: kvm-devel-bounces-5NWGOfrQmneRv+LV9MX5uipxlwaOVQ5f@public.gmane.org List-Id: kvm.vger.kernel.org Howdy, Does anyone know what the state of a pv_ops backend for KVM is? I know Ingo has an implementation that implements CR3 caching but I don't see any branches in Avi's git tree. Perhaps we should try for a simple pv_ops backend for 2.6.23 seeing as how the host infrastructure is there? I'd be willing to do some leg work here...
